Prince Amoako Junior Shines Again As Nordsjaelland Beat Vejle 3-0

Ghanaian youngster Prince Amoako Junior continues to make waves in Denmark after registering another assist in FC Nordsjaelland’s emphatic 3-0 victory over Vejle.

The 18-year-old forward played a crucial role in setting up the second goal, taking his season tally to six goal contributions, four goals and two assists in just 11 league matches.

Amoako’s consistent performances have earned praise from both fans and pundits, as he cements his place as one of Nordsjaelland’s most promising talents. His pace, creativity, and confidence on the ball have been central to the club’s strong start to the season.

The Ghanaian teenager, who graduated from the Right to Dream Academy, continues to show maturity beyond his years, raising hopes of a future call-up to the Black Stars.

With his current form, Amoako Junior looks set to play a key role in Nordsjaelland’s push for a top-four finish in the Danish Superliga.
